Two different websites offer the same watch for sale. The watch costs $45 on both sites. The site, Watches for Less charges a shipping fee of 4% of the cost of the watch. The site, Tick Tock charges 2.5% of the cost of the watch for shipping. How much less will the total cost of the watch be if purchased from Tick Tock?
Round your answer to the hundredths place.
Answer:
$0.67
Step-by-step explanation:
Cost of Watch on both sites=$45
Watches for Less charges a shipping fee of 4% of the cost of the watch.
Therefore, total cost of the watch at Watches for Less
=$45+(4% of 45)=45+(0.04 X 45)
=45+1.8
=$46.8
Tick Tock charges 2.5% of the cost of the watch for shipping.
Therefore, total cost of the watch at Tick Tock
=$45+(2.5% of 45)=(45+0.025X45)
=45+1.13
=$46.13
Difference In Cost
Cost at Watches for Less-Cost at Tick Tock
=$46.8-46.13
=$0.67
The total cost of the watch will be $0.67 less if purchased from Tick Tock

We have Bret buys a dining table that costs $150 before tax. The sales tax is 8%.
Assume that he paid $[x] as sales tax. Then, we can write -
[x] = 8% of 150
[x] = (8/100) x 150
[x] = 12
Therefore, Bret paid $12 as sales tax.

To calculate how many 2-inch segments are there in 12 feet, we need to convert both measurements to the same unit before performing the division.
Step 1: Convert 12 feet to inches.
Since 1 foot is equal to 12 inches, to convert 12 feet to inches, we multiply by 12:
12 feet * 12 inches/foot = 144 inches
Step 2: Divide the total number of inches by the length of each segment (2 inches).
144 inches ÷ 2 inches/segment = 72 segments
Therefore, there are 72 two-inch segments in 12 feet.
